Lebanon says Mossad behind Sidon assassination attempt

Saturday 27-January-2018

The Lebanese Interior Ministry on Friday confirmed Israel’s involvement in the car bomb attack that targeted a Hamas official in the southern city of Sidon nearly two weeks ago.

The information office of Lebanon’s Interior Minister Nohad Machnouk said in a statement that the information division has completed the investigation and it now has the full scenario of the assassination attempt.

The office pointed out that the Ministry was able to find one of the main perpetrators of the crime who admitted that he was tasked by the Mossad to carry out the attack.

Last Tuesday Turkey handed over to the Lebanese authorities the suspect in the failed assassination attempt Mohammed Beitieh. The Lebanese newspaper al-Diyar said that the Turkish authorities decided to hand Beitieh over after they arrested him in Istanbul based on a request by the Lebanese Interior Ministry.

The Information office affirmed that advanced communication devices containing regular letters between Beitieh and those who recruited him were found in Beitieh’s house.

About ten days ago the Hamas official Mohammed Hamdan was injured after his car exploded in Sidon city. Hamas Movement then affirmed that the initial investigation indicates that Israel is behind the attack.
